In a paper called Five Steps to Online Effectiveness for Political Leaders, Bailey Hill Media advises political campaigns to “ask questions, use polls, and respond to feedback. Be prepared for conversations coming from people who interact with your content. It’s this interaction that builds the type of strong voter relationships that can help you win elections.”
Mixpo Xspots include a number of features that foster dynamic interactions between advertisers and the audiences they target. The latest addition to this feature list, of particular interest to political campaigns, is polling.
